BlackRock MuniYield Pennsylvania Quality Fund (MPA) has announced a dividend payment of $0.0660 per share, with an ex-dividend date set for Sep 15, 2025. This dividend, declared on Sep 2, 2025, will be distributed on Oct 1, 2025. The upcoming payout represents a slight increase compared to the average of the last 10 dividends, which stood at approximately $0.0632 per share, indicating a positive trend in the fund’s income distribution. The most recent dividend, also amounting to $0.0660 per share, was announced on the same date as this current declaration, signaling consistency in the fund’s payout pattern. The type of dividend remains a cash distribution, consistent with the fund’s strategy of delivering regular income to investors. Over the past week, several key developments have emerged regarding the fund. Reports indicate a notable decline in short interest, with shares falling by over 43% in August, reflecting reduced bearish sentiment among traders. This trend suggests growing confidence in the fund’s stability and long-term performance. Additionally, the fund has crossed above its 200-day moving average, a technical indicator often associated with potential upward momentum in the stock price. Source reported that this movement could signal a short-term improvement in investor sentiment and a possible continuation of positive price action. Meanwhile, the fund’s current yield remains competitive, with a yield of approximately 6.98% as of late, reflecting its appeal as an income-oriented investment. These factors collectively contribute to a favorable environment for MPA shareholders.
In light of these recent updates, the BlackRock MuniYield Pennsylvania Quality Fund appears to be maintaining a consistent and reliable dividend policy while showing signs of improved market performance. With a strong yield, declining short interest, and a recent breakout above key technical levels, the fund continues to attract attention from income-focused investors. However, as with any investment, it is essential to monitor the fund’s underlying asset quality and management strategy to fully assess its long-term viability. The ex-dividend date of Sep 15, 2025, is the last day for investors to purchase the stock and receive this dividend payment. Any shares acquired after this date will not be eligible for the distribution. Investors should plan accordingly to align their strategies with the fund’s upcoming payout schedule.
